3 Easy Ways to Make Perfect Kotleti: Slow Cooker, Instant Pot, and Air Fryer Methods

Slow Cooker Kotleti: Juicy, Tender Patties with Minimal Effort

Use the slow cooker to cook the meat mixture slowly, ensuring that the patties turn out juicy and tender. The slow, even heat helps the flavors develop while keeping the kotleti moist and succulent. You can also use it to simmer the patties in a flavorful sauce for added richness.

Instant Pot Kotleti: Quick, Moist, and Crispy Patties in No Time

Use the Instant Pot's "saute" function to brown the kotleti patties first, and then switch to "pressure cook" to cook them through in a fraction of the time. This method locks in moisture, creating a crisp exterior and a tender, juicy interior, without the long wait.

Air Fryer Kotleti: Perfectly Crispy, Golden Patties with Less Oil

After shaping your kotleti, place them in the air fryer for a crisp, golden-brown crust without the need for deep frying. The "air crisp" function ensures an even cook with minimal oil, giving you healthier, crispy kotleti with all the flavor.

Tips and Suggestions on Kotleti Batter

Consistency

getting the right consistency of the batter is key. Too thick and the kotleti won't cook through, too thin and the batter won't stick to the meat.

Flavor

the batter should complement the flavor of the meat. Consider adding spices or herbs to the batter to enhance the overall taste.

Binding

the batter should help the meat stick together. Make sure you have enough eggs or other binding agents in the batter

Texture

the batter should be smooth and even. Any lumps will affect the texture of the kotleti.

Crispness

aim for a crispy coating. Make sure the oil is hot enough and don't overcrowd the pan.

Time

take your time when frying the kotleti. Rushing can result in undercooked meat or burnt batter

Quantity

make sure you have enough batter to coat all the kotleti. Running out of batter mid-cooking can be frustrating and affect the overall outcome.

Traditional Kotleti Batter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 cup of oatmeal
  • 1/2 cup of flour
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1/2 tsp of salt
  • Pepper to taste
  • Oil for frying

Instructions

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the oatmeal, flour, chopped onion, beaten egg, salt, and pepper.
  2. Mix until you reach a smooth, homogenous consistency.
  3. Form the mixture into small, flattened patties, about 2-3 inches in diameter and 1/2 inch thick.
  4.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
  5. Drop the patties into the skillet, making sure not to overcrowd the pan.
  6. Fry for about 3-4 minutes per side, until golden brown.
  7. Remove from the skillet and drain on paper towels.
  8. Serve hot as a main course or appetizer with mashed potatoes and pickles.

Cooking Time

Preparation Time 10 min

Cook Time 20 min

Total time 30 min
